Why Military Is Recording Successes Against Terrorists — CSO

A civil society organisation, the Coalition for National Security Advancement (CONSA), has attributed recent gains recorded by the Nigerian Armed Forces in the fight against terrorism, kidnapping, and oil theft to leadership style, operational coordination, and inter-service synergy under the Chief of Defence Staff, Gen. Olufemi Oluyede.

The group said the military had recorded notable successes in recent operations, including the killing of over 175 terrorists in coordinated offensives across various theatres of operation. It added that the renewed tempo of military campaigns reflects a more strategic and intelligence-driven approach to tackling insecurity.

Speaking at a press conference in Abuja on Thursday, the Executive Director of CONSA, James Adama, said the successes were largely due to improved collaboration among the Nigerian Army, Air Force, and Navy under the defence leadership.

He also said troops had neutralised several high-profile terrorist commanders whose activities posed grave threats to national security, including the reported elimination of Abu Bakr al-Mainuki, described by Nigerian and U.S. officials as the second-in-command of the Islamic State group globally, during a joint Nigeria–United States operation in the Lake Chad Basin.

Adama said the operation underscored the effectiveness of intelligence gathering, international cooperation, and precision military coordination, adding that it had weakened the operational capabilities of terrorist networks within and beyond Nigeria’s borders.

The CSO also commended the Armed Forces for intensifying rescue operations, noting that several kidnapped victims had been freed from terrorist enclaves and criminal hideouts through sustained military pressure and coordinated ground offensives in affected regions.

He further praised ongoing efforts to tackle crude oil theft and pipeline vandalism in the Niger Delta, stating that security operations had dismantled illegal refining camps, disrupted economic sabotage networks, and strengthened protection of critical national assets.

“The current leadership style of the Armed Forces under the Chief of Defence Staff has encouraged professionalism, discipline, and synergy among the services. What we are witnessing today are measurable outcomes of a coordinated military structure,” Adama said.

While acknowledging that security challenges remain in parts of the country, the organisation urged citizens to support security agencies with timely and credible intelligence to sustain ongoing gains against criminal elements.

CONSA expressed optimism that with sustained operational synergy and strategic leadership, Nigeria would record further progress in defeating terrorism, combating organised crime, and securing critical economic infrastructure.
